Seychelles: Bird Island – crabs, tortoises, and more

Bird Island is not just birds but tons of other rare wildlife as well – there are about 20 giant Aldabra tortoises roaming the grounds (in fact the largest tortoise in the world lives here!), several species of crabs both land and marine, rare skinks and geckos, and some more endemic and very beautiful birds.